I agree she inspired a lot of People I disagree she didn't create a new field in photography. Albert Renger Patzsch did and gets too little credit for it. The Bechers are the post war continuation of the Neue Sachlichkeit Fotografie as done by Patzsch. Still like her work do not like the Düsseldorf School which is little more than a spiced up Version of the Neue Sachlichkeit with a bit of mininal art thrown in. But that's not the Bechers fault but the Art Market and the German Governments which desperately wanted a new german art at all cost.
